DIMAPUR — Ministry of Health and Family Welfare, government of India, has launched the sixth round of National Family Health Survey, popularly known as NFHS-6 in Nagaland with the objective of estimating reliable indicators of population, maternal and child health and family planning at the district, state and national levels.

The International Institute for Population Sciences (IIPS), Mumbai, an autonomous institute of the ministry of Health and Family Welfare, is the nodal agency for conducting the survey on behalf of the ministry. The IIPS in turn has engaged field agencies to carry out the survey.

In this regard, the Centre for Market Research and Social Development Pvt. Ltd. (CMRSD) has been appointed as field agency to conduct the survey in Nagaland for NFHS-6. It added that CMRSD has successfully completed household listing and the team is planning to conduct detailed household survey and health tests from the selected primary sampling units (PSUs) in Nagaland during July to December, 2023, or till end of survey.

During the main survey, trained field teams would be visit various selected primary sampling units (villages) and urban areas for conduct of household survey and health tests in the districts.
